MetaTrader 5 Client Terminal build 316

Terminal: Оптимизирована и ускорена работа с памятью при распаковке и обработке котировок

27 августа 2010

  1. Terminal: Оптимизирована и ускорена работа с памятью при распаковке и обработке котировок.
  2. Terminal: Добавлена проверка некорректных параметров рисования для графических объектов и пользовательских индикаторов.
  3. MQL5: Исправлено падение терминала при критических ошибках MQL5 программ для х64.
  4. MQL5: Исправлена проверка чисел с плавающей точкой на равенство 0 для х64.
  5. MQL5: Исправлена ошибка нормализации плавающих чисел (NormalizeDouble) для больших значений нормализуемого числа.
  6. MQL5: Исправлена ошибка приведения типов констант.
  7. MQL5: Исправлена ошибка приведения переменных типа bool к типу string.
  8. MQL5: Исправлена ошибка приведения чисел с плавающей точкой к строке для х64.
  9. MQL5: Исправлено копирование данных в индикаторный буфер, в случае когда размер буфера больше чем количество данных.
  10. MQL5: Значительно ускорена компиляция MQL5 программ.
  11. MQL5: В стандартную библиотеку добавлены классы для написания торговых советников (MQL5\Include\Expert). Добавлены примеры торговых экспертов написанных с помощью этих классов (MQL5\Experts\Advisors).
  12. Tester: Добавлена возможность настройки плеча торгового счёта в параметрах тестирования и оптимизации.
  13. Tester: Исправлена работа контекстной справки во вкладке параметров эксперта.
  14. Tester: Добавлено новое состояние удалённого агента "Connecting" - осуществляется подключение к агенту.
  15. Исправления по сообщениям на форуме и крешлогам.